src/EditRecipe.cpp

changeset 98
1425bf3e18ed
parent 97
8283bbf95806
child 99
053c0578cf58
--- a/src/EditRecipe.cpp	Thu Mar 31 23:10:57 2022 +0200
+++ b/src/EditRecipe.cpp	Fri Apr 01 14:58:57 2022 +0200
@@ -34,6 +34,12 @@
     ui->typeEdit->addItem(tr("Partial Mash"));
     ui->typeEdit->addItem(tr("All Grain"));
 
+    ui->color_methodEdit->addItem("Morey");
+    ui->color_methodEdit->addItem("Mosher");
+    ui->color_methodEdit->addItem("Daniels");
+    ui->color_methodEdit->addItem("Halberstadt");
+    ui->color_methodEdit->addItem("Naudts");
+
     if (id >= 0) {
 	query.prepare("SELECT * FROM recipes WHERE record = :recno");
 	query.bindValue(":recno", id);
@@ -87,17 +93,13 @@
 
 	ui->est_colorEdit->setValue(query.value(31).toDouble());
 	QColor color = Utils::ebc_to_color(query.value(31).toInt());
+	ui->est_colorEdit->setStyleSheet(Utils::ebc_to_style(query.value(31).toInt()));
 	ui->est_colorGlass->setColor(color);
         ui->est_colorShow->setPrecision(0);
-        ui->est_colorShow->setMarkerTextIsValue(true);
+        ui->est_colorShow->setMarkerTextIsValue(false);
 	ui->est_colorShow->setRange(query.value(15).toDouble(), query.value(16).toDouble());
         ui->est_colorShow->setValue(query.value(31).toDouble());
 
-	ui->color_methodEdit->addItem("Morey");
-    	ui->color_methodEdit->addItem("Mosher");
-    	ui->color_methodEdit->addItem("Daniels");
-    	ui->color_methodEdit->addItem("Halberstadt");
-    	ui->color_methodEdit->addItem("Naudts");
 	ui->color_methodEdit->setCurrentIndex(query.value(32).toInt());
 
 	// 33 est_ibu
@@ -291,7 +293,7 @@
 void EditRecipe::on_quitButton_clicked()
 {
     if (this->textIsChanged) {
-	int rc = QMessageBox::warning(this, tr("Recipe changed"), tr("The ingredient has been modified. Save changes?"),
+	int rc = QMessageBox::warning(this, tr("Recipe changed"), tr("The recipe has been modified. Save changes?"),
                                 QMessageBox::Save | QMessageBox::Discard | QMessageBox::Cancel, QMessageBox::Save);
         switch (rc) {
             case QMessageBox::Save:

mercurial